Pride and pain for families as they mark the end of Afghanistan war
Telegraph.co.uk
Hundreds of mothers, still grieving, sat in the rows behind, remembering the 150,000 British service men and women who served in Afghanistan, and the 453 who never returned home. Most of all, they were thinking of their son or their daughter ...
